    Hello ma'am.. I'm 23 years old and I have 4×3 CM Fibroadinuma in my left breast.. Is it dangerous?..Is any solution for it expect surgery?... Does Fibroadinuma dissolve itself some time? Plz suggest

    • @CancerEdInstitute
      @CancerEdInstitute  2 роки тому +1

      Hello Archana, we cannot simply suggest what to do without knowing your medical background and tests, but you can have the fibroadenoma removed for three reasons: 1) to have a peace of mind, 2) to know the pathology and confirm if it is truly Fibroadenoma, and 3) to avoid causing it to you problems later (e.g. it might grow larger and/or causing other issues). Depending on what they've seen, if it is a cyst, the surgeon may use a needle to remove the liquid, but if it is solid, then they'll remove it surgically. In general, fibroadenoma is common in women and it is not malignant (not cancerous), but you want to make sure that it truly is. Our suggestion is the following: 1) talk with your doctor about your concerns and that if he/she can explain you more in detail what to expect, and 2) if still in doubt, get a second opinion from a gynecologist.
